Role Details

This position is based at our facility. The working hours are from 9:00 am to 5:00 pm, Monday to Friday, with weekend shifts required on a rotational basis. You will have two days off during the week if you work a weekend.

Responsibilities Include:

  • Preparing a comprehensive menu for families, children, and staff that reflects flexibility and sensitivity to dietary needs.
  • Collaborating with Care Team staff and families regarding special dietary requirements, considering cultural or religious preferences.
  • Maintaining the Hazard Analysis Critical Control Points (HACCP) management system, ensuring compliance and high standards.
  • Ensuring all kitchen equipment is kept clean and safe, reporting any issues to the Catering Manager.
  • Planning for menu and food preparation in advance to cover for absences, coordinating with team members as necessary.

Essential Qualifications

  • NVQ Level 2 in Food Safety & Hygiene.
  • Experience in kitchen management.
  • Understanding of Food Safety Regulations.
  • Ability to prepare fresh meals from scratch using quality ingredients.
  • Knowledge of catering for special diets.

Desirable Qualifications

  • NVQ Level 3 in Food Safety & Hygiene or working towards this qualification.
  • Experience in catering for events.
  • Knowledge of allergies and intolerances.
  • High proficiency in desserts and cakes.
  • Familiarity with HACCP, COSHH, and Health and Safety regulations.
  • Understanding of dietary needs for patients with serious illnesses.
